Dual - processes in conditional inference behaviour 1

134 words) We examined a large set of conditional inference data compiled from several previous studies and asked three questions: how is normative performance related to intelligence, does negative conclusion bias stem from Type 1 or Type 2 processing, and does implicit negation bias stem from Type 1 or Type 2 processing? Our analysis demonstrated that a) rejecting denial of the antecedent and affirmation of the consequent inferences was positively correlated with intelligence, while endorsing MT inferences was not, b) the occurrence of negative conclusion bias was related to the extent of Type 2 processing, and c) that the occurrence of implicit negation bias was not related to extent of Type 2 processing. We conclude that negative conclusion bias is, at least in part, a product of Type 2 processing while implicit negation bias is not.

A spatial point process is a random pattern of points in d-dimensional space (where usually d = 2 or d = 3 in applications). Spatial point processes are useful as statistical models in the analysis of observed patterns of points, where the points represent the locations of some object of study (e..g. trees in a forest, bird nests, disease cases, or petty crimes).
